Tensions within NATO are escalating as Canada joins France and the UK in pledging to recognize the State of Palestine at the upcoming UN General Assembly. Prime Minister Mark Carney cited Gaza’s worsening humanitarian crisis as the reason, drawing a sharp rebuke from U.S. President Donald Trump, who threatened to withhold trade deals. With over 154 hunger-related deaths in Gaza and famine looming, NATO’s once-unified stance appears fractured. As European leaders call for a two-state solution, the U.S. isolates itself, siding firmly with Israel, whose government has denounced the recognition drive as a reward for terrorism.
